titleOfInvention | Method of forming a transparent conductive layer on a substrate |
abstract | The present invention provides a method of forming a transparent conductive layer on a substrate, comprising: applying a conductive composition comprising a conductive polymer to a substrate to form a transparent conductive layer on the substrate; forming a patterned protective layer on the transparent conductive a transparent conductive layer region covered by the protective layer and a transparent conductive layer region not covered by the protective layer; wet etching the transparent conductive layer region covered by the unprotected layer; and removing the protective layer Wherein the transparent conductive layer is annealed before or after the wet etching. The method provided by the invention can reduce the chromatic aberration caused by the transparent conductive layer between the etched portion and the unetched portion; and the method of the invention is simpler than the conventional method because the invention does not need to use an additional optical layer to reduce the chromatic aberration. And more economical. |
